Water Extraction After Sewage Events
Standing water mixed with sewage requires immediate removal using equipment rated for contaminated conditions. Homes throughout Carrollton and Addison benefit from fast water extraction that limits how far contaminated water spreads into flooring and wall cavities after a backup.
Structural Drying for Affected Areas
Once contaminated water is removed, moisture trapped in walls, subfloors, and framing must be addressed before it causes lasting damage. Richardson's humid summers make thorough drying especially important, and quality structural drying services help prevent secondary deterioration in affected rooms.
Odor Removal Following Sewage Exposure
Sewage odors penetrate porous materials quickly and can linger long after visible cleanup is complete. Homes in Frisco and The Colony with finished basements or carpeted lower levels often need targeted odor treatment as a follow-up step to full sewage cleanup.
Mold Inspection After Moisture Exposure
Sewage backups introduce both moisture and organic material, creating conditions where mold can develop within days. Scheduling a reliable mold inspection after sewage cleanup gives Richardson homeowners confirmation that hidden growth has not taken hold inside walls or under flooring.

How Sewage Cleanup Needs Shift Across Richardson's Climate Calendar
Richardson's weather patterns create distinct sewage cleanup pressures in each season, and staying ahead of those changes protects your home year-round.
Spring Sewage Cleanup Readiness in Richardson, TX
Spring in Richardson, TX brings some of the region's heaviest rainfall, and that precipitation can quickly overwhelm older sewer infrastructure. Homeowners near Sunnyvale and Fairview often see backup calls spike during March and April when sustained rain pushes ground saturation to its limits and drainage systems struggle to keep pace.

Summer Sewage Cleanup Demands in Richardson, TX
Richardson, TX summers bring intense heat combined with periodic severe storms, a combination that stresses both plumbing systems and municipal sewer lines simultaneously. Homes in Coppell and Rockwall experience similar pressure patterns, and when storm surges hit, emergency water removal services work alongside sewage cleanup to address the full scope of damage quickly.

Fall Sewage Cleanup Preparation in Richardson, TX
As temperatures begin to drop in Richardson, TX, shifting soil conditions can place stress on sewer laterals, increasing the chance of slow drains and partial blockages before winter arrives. Homeowners in Wylie and Lucas who address minor drainage issues in the fall tend to avoid more serious backup situations when cold weather settles in.
Winter Sewage Cleanup Response in Richardson, TX
Richardson, TX winters occasionally bring freezing temperatures that can affect exposed plumbing and sewer connections, especially in homes with older construction. When a freeze event is followed by a rapid warm-up, the resulting pressure changes can trigger backups that require prompt sewage cleanup to prevent contamination from spreading through lower-level living spaces.
